Просмотр исходного кода

Remove EVCPID and ERC from FPNC connectors
https://dev.wormwood.com.sg/zentao/task-view-223.html

vbea 2 лет назад
Родитель
Сommit
57bd95d7cc

+ 1 - 0
Strides-Admin/src/settings.js

@@ -16,6 +16,7 @@ module.exports = {
   dashboardVersion: 2,
   enableWebPos: true,
   enableTopup: false,
+  enableEVCPID: true,
   /**
    * @type {string}
    * @description API url base service

+ 4 - 2
Strides-Admin/src/views/charge/AddStation.vue

@@ -33,7 +33,7 @@
               </el-form-item>
             </el-col>
           </el-row>
-          <el-row :gutter="20">
+          <el-row :gutter="20" v-if="enableEVCPID">
             <el-col :xs="24" :md="24">
               <el-form-item
                 label="EVCPID:"
@@ -363,6 +363,7 @@
   import station from '../../http/api/charge'
   import provider from '../../http/api/provider'
   import handleClipboard from '@/utils/clipboard'
+  import settings from '../../settings'
   export default {
     data() {
       return {
@@ -481,7 +482,8 @@
           connectorPk: '',
           chargeTypePk: ''
         },
-        isEdit: false
+        isEdit: false,
+        enableEVCPID: settings.enableEVCPID
       }
     },
     created() {

+ 4 - 2
Strides-Admin/src/views/charge/Connectors.vue

@@ -89,7 +89,8 @@
       <el-table-column
         label="ERC"
         align="center"
-        width="120">
+        width="120"
+        v-if="enableEVCPID">
         <template slot-scope="{row}">
           <span>{{ row.evcpId + "-" + row.connectorId }}</span>
         </template>
@@ -251,7 +252,8 @@ export default {
         visible: false,
         item: {}
       },
-      enableWebPos: settings.enableWebPos
+      enableWebPos: settings.enableWebPos,
+      enableEVCPID: settings.enableEVCPID
     }
   },
   created() {